SMARTS COMMUNITY ART SCHOOL PROVIDES ACCESS AND EARLY TRAINING IN THE ARTS FOR OUR REGION'S K-12 YOUTH WITH A FOCUS ON UNDERSERVED POPULATIONS. SMARTS ENGAGES PUBLIC AND PRIVATE ORGANIZATIONS, SCHOOLS, AND ARTISTS IN COOPERATIVE PROJECTS DESIGNED TO ENRICH OUR COMMUNITY, PROMOTE STUDENT ACHIEVEMENT, INSPIRE SELF-DISCOVERY, AND IMPACT CULTURAL AND ACADEMIC LITERACY THROUGH FINE AND PERFORMING ARTS
